Web12 jan. 2016 · The pitch is how steep the threads are. On US nuts and bolts, they are measured according to the number of threads per inch. So a pitch of 20 would have 20 threads per inch. For metric nuts and bolts, it's measured in mm per thread, so a 1.50 pitch will be a thread every 1.5 mm. Web14 jan. 2024 · A frequency is a representation of pitch measured by Hz. Hertz represent how many times a sound wave vibrates in one second. So a note measured at 440 Hz completes 440 vibrations per second. Slow vibrations, or lower values, result in deeper pitches, while faster vibrations (higher values) sound higher. Web26 jul. 2024 · In gearing terms, there are two types of pitch: circular and diametric. Circular Circular pitch is the distance from a point on one tooth to the corresponding point on the next tooth measured along the pitch circle as shown in Figure 57. 32. Its value is equal to the circumference of the pitch circle divided by the number of teeth in the gear.
